Washington Redskins News: DeSean Jackson wants No. 10 jersey from RG3? Will Griffin to wear No. 3 in 2014? [VIDEO]

The honeymoon in Washington might already be over as rumors swirl that DeSean Jackson wants Robert Griffin III’s No. 10 jersey for himself in 2014.

It wouldn’t be the first time time that a new player comes to his new team and wants to wear the number he worse on his previous team. This case is interesting, however, because jerseys have been known to be very territorial and for a leader like RGIII to surrender his jersey could be viewed as a sign of weakness. Jackson has already commented on the jersey and said he and Griffin talked about it.

"I definitely am familiar with the No. 10 on Robert Griffin," Jackson said during a conference call. "But, you know, we've talked about it a little bit, but there hasn’t been a decision that’s been made yet so far, but maybe by the time season starts we'll know. But maybe RGIII will wear No. 3 and I'll try to get in 10. We'll see how it goes though. Never know.”

This issue should be resolved very quickly and expect RGIII to keep his jersey number. Sleep easy Redskins nation, you wont have to buy a new Griffin jersey anytime soon. Some recent stories concerning teammates giving up jerseys include Jets wide receiver Eric Decker paying tight end Jeff Cumberland $25,000 and a steak dinner for the rights to his No. 87.
